2010-8-16 ILCL exhibition "Barrier-free Picture Books from Around the World - IBBY Outstanding Books for Young People with Disabilities 2009"
![]()
From Aug 21, the International Library of Children's Literature will hold an exhibition of picture books especially made for disabled young people, commemorating the 10th Anniversary of the Opening of the International Library of Children's Literature and also the National Year of Reading.
Fifty works from 21 countries selected by the IBBY Documentation Centre of Books for Disabled Young People are exhibited. To experience them yourself, you can pick up and enjoy all barrier-free picture books such as those with Braille and sign language, three dimensional cloth books with transformable dolls, and various other kinds of books.
